The South Fork township is a subdivision of the Audrain County, in the state of Missouri.
This subdivision represents an area of 47 square miles - 2 square miles are water areas.
There are 2 cities, towns or villages in the South Fork township subdivision - their combined population count is 4.670.
Approximatelly 761 people live in “Remainders” areas, that are officially not part of any city or town.
Total population of the subdivision is 5.431.
Racial makeup of this subdivision is as follows : White (83.98%),
followed by Black or African American (9.32%) and Some Other Race (2.58%).
Median age for the male population is 31 and 38 for the female part.
